Felix ‘Worechan’ Chah BA, MBA
Felix Chah popularly known as worechan was born in Guzang, attended secondary and High schools at the then PSS Batibo and GHS Mbengwei respectively. He graduated
in the first batch of the economics Department of ENS Bambili, University of Yaoundé with a Bachelor in Economics and Education. Taught in GHS Batibo from 1993 – 1997. He was later posted to GHS
Balikumbat where he taught economics, Geography and mathematics from 1997- 2003. He equally obtained a diploma in soccer refereeing, and handled soccer matches with the Cameroon football
federation from 1998 – 2003. He also headed the economics department for GHS Balikumbat from 1999-2003 and at the same time coordinated the school’s sporting activities. He moved to
the United States and work with Guardsmark LLC from 2004 -2010. He is expected to graduate from Bowie State University on May 21, 2010 with an MBA in Finance. Worechan is a highly devoted Christian, was a church elder and chairman of the Presbyterian Church in Cameroon, Balikumbat congregation from 1998-2003.
Hobbies: He loves playing scrabble, checkers and equally writing articles/comments about soccer especially on BBC world service- African sports
(fast track).
